Nestled peacefully in the heart of India, Gwalior stands as a timeless testament to the grandeur of history and the vibrancy of culture. From the imposing Gwalior Fort, which dominates the skyline with its ancient walls and storied past, to the resplendent Jai Vilas Palace, a brilliant fusion of Indian and European architecture, this city exudes an air of regal elegance. Stroll through its bustling markets, where centuries-old traditions blend seamlessly with modernity, or lose yourself in the melodic strains of classical music that echo through its streets. Gwalior is a city that whispers tales of bygone eras while embracing the promise of tomorrow.
